Creating images with Stable Diffusion to find a good seed to go with prompt

import torch | |
from diffusers import StableDiffusionPipeline | |
from torch import autocast | |
import random | |
import matplotlib.pyplot as plt | |
import os | |
prompts = [ | |
"1965 Porsche 911", | |
"1975 Porsche 911", | |
"1985 Porsche 911", | |
"1995 Porsche 911", | |
"2005 Porsche 911 front", | |
"2015 Porsche 911", | |
"2020 Porsche 911", | |
"2020 Porsche 911 GT3 RS"] | |
# make sure you're logged in with `huggingface-cli login` | |
pipe = StableDiffusionPipeline.from_pretrained("CompVis/stable-diffusion-v1-4", | |
revision="fp16", | |
torch_dtype=torch.float16, | |
use_auth_token=True) | |
pipe = pipe.to("cuda") | |
def infer(prompt, num_inference_steps=50, | |
samples=5, seed=1024, guidance_scale=7.5, | |
width=512, height=512): | |
generator = torch.Generator("cuda").manual_seed(seed) | |
w = width//8*8 | |
h = height//8*8 | |
with autocast("cuda"): | |
image = pipe(prompt, guidance_scale=7.5, | |
generator=generator, width=w, height=h, | |
num_inference_steps=num_inference_steps)["sample"][0] | |
return image | |
for p in prompts: | |
prompt_orig = p | |
if not os.path.exists("imagery"): | |
os.mkdir("imagery") | |
if not os.path.exists(f"imagery/{prompt_orig}"): | |
os.mkdir(f"imagery/{prompt_orig}/") | |
HM = 200 | |
for i in range(HM): | |
print(f"{i+1}/{HM}") | |
prompt_to_use = prompt_orig | |
seed = random.randint(0, 10000) | |
print(seed) | |
image = infer(prompt_to_use, num_inference_steps=75, | |
seed=seed, width=512, height=512) | |
image.save(f"imagery/{prompt_to_use}/{seed}.png") |
